崛起中的九大HTML5開發工具

ctocio發表於2012-08-26

  HTML5被看做是web開發者建立流行web應用的利器,增加了對視訊和Canvas 2D的支援。HTML5的誕生還讓人們重新審視瀏覽器專用多媒體外掛的未來,如Adobe的Flash和微軟的Silverlight,HTML5為實現這些外掛的功能提供了一種標準化的方式。

  雖然HTML5標準尚未開發完成,但是隨著開發者對HTML5的興趣日漸濃厚,開發工具提供商也開始跟進。以下介紹的9款應用工具已經能夠幫助開發者在程式中整合HTML5功能。

一、Adobe Edge

  目前還處於預覽階段的Adobe Edge 是用HTML5、CSS、JavaScript開發動態互動內容的設計工具。內容可以同時相容移動裝置和桌面電腦。Edge的一個重要功能是web工具包介面,方便確保頁面在不同瀏覽器中的架構一致性,此外Edge還將整合TypeKit這樣的字型服務。

  動畫和圖形可以新增到HTML元素中,程式也能通過Edge自身的程式碼片段庫或者JavaScript程式碼進行擴充套件。動畫可以在獨立的時間線上進行巢狀,還能實現互動功能。符合可以服用並通過API和程式碼片段控制。通過Edge設計的內容可以相容iOS和Android裝置,也可以執行在火狐、Chrome、Safari和IE9等主流瀏覽器。

 

二、Adobe Dreamweaver CS6

  Adobe Dreamweaver CS6作為一個web設計軟體,提供了對HTML網站和移動程式的視覺化編輯介面。其Fluid Grid 排版系統整合CSS樣式表功能,提供自適應版面的跨平臺相容性。開發者可以完全實現web設計的視覺化操作,無需為程式碼所困。

  使用者不但還能在Live View中預覽,還提供多螢幕預覽功能。開發者可以通過MultiScreen預覽皮膚檢視HTML5內容的渲染效果。Live View通過WebKit渲染引擎支援HTML5。

三、Adobe ColdFusion 10

  ColdFusion是用來開發企業web程式的伺服器端技術,通過websockets、互動表單、視訊和地理標籤等HTML5技術建立富媒體使用者體驗。

四、Sencha Architect 2

  在開發移動和桌面應用的工具中,Sencha的定位是HTML5視覺化應用開發。開發團隊可以在一個單一整合的環境中完成應用的設計、開發和部署。開發者還可以開發Sencha Touch2和Ext JS4 JavaScript應用,並實時預覽。

五、Sencha Touch 2

  Sencha Touch2是移動應用框架,也被看作是Sencha的HTML5平臺。開發者可以用它開發面向iOS、Android和Blackberry、Kindle Fire等多種平臺的移動應用。

六、Dojo Foundation Maqetta

  來自於IBM的一個專案,Dojo Foundation Maqetta是為桌面和移動裝置開發HTML5應用的開源工具,支援在瀏覽器中檢視HTML5介面。使用者體驗設計師可以通過拖放組裝UI樣板。

七、微軟Visual Studio 2010 ServicePack 1

  雖然一開始並不支援HTML5,但微軟在2011年三月釋出的Visual Studio 2010  SP1中提供了IntelliSense,追加了針對HTML5的一些元素。

八、JetBrains WebStorm 4.0

  作為擁有HTML編輯器的JavaScript整合開發環境,WebStorm4.0提供了開發web應用的HTML5樣板。開發者可以在建立HTML文件時可獲得對HTML5檔案的支援。例如砍伐者鍵入<ca時,系統會提示<canvas>。開發者還可以在chrome瀏覽器中實時預覽HTML文件。

九 Google Web Toolkit

  該開發工具用於開發瀏覽器應用,但庫中支援很多HTML5功能。包括對客戶端或web儲存的支援。其他HTML5功能還包括支援Canvas視覺化,以及音訊和視訊widget。

相關文章